Every May they pass through here on their way to Appleby Fair in Cumbria - there are rows of Romany caravans lined up in a dead-end lane and shaggy coloured ponies tethered on the verges. God knows where they all originate or how long it takes them to do the journey, but DH used to drive that way to work and one year he passed the same caravan every day for 3 days over a stretch of about 30 miles. They are fascinating.

(The fair is on from 2-8 June, main days Sat 4 - Mon 6, if anyone's interested in going.)
